Tribal Tattoos
Tribal tattoos are among the oldest and most enduring forms of body art. Originating from various indigenous cultures around the world, including Polynesian, Maori, and Celtic traditions, these designs often represent ancestry, lineage, and social status. The intricate patterns and bold lines of tribal tattoos can symbolize strength, courage, and connection to one’s roots. When considering tattoo designs and meanings for men, tribal art offers a powerful link to heritage.
- Polynesian Tattoos: Often depict elements of nature, such as waves, sharks, and turtles, each carrying specific meanings related to protection, guidance, and resilience.
- Maori Tattoos (Ta Moko): Traditionally used to convey social standing, personal history, and achievements. The designs are unique to each individual and are considered sacred.
- Celtic Tattoos: Feature intricate knotwork and interwoven patterns, symbolizing eternity, interconnectedness, and the cyclical nature of life.
Animal Tattoos
Animal tattoos are another popular choice for men, each animal carrying its own symbolic weight. From fierce predators to gentle creatures, animal tattoos can represent a range of qualities and characteristics. Understanding the associated tattoo designs and meanings for men helps in selecting an animal that aligns with personal attributes.
- Lion Tattoos: Symbolize courage, strength, leadership, and royalty. Often chosen by men who aspire to embody these qualities.
- Wolf Tattoos: Represent loyalty, family, intuition, and freedom. Wolves are often seen as solitary creatures with a strong pack mentality.
- Eagle Tattoos: Symbolize freedom, vision, power, and patriotism. Eagles are often associated with soaring above challenges and having a clear perspective.
- Dragon Tattoos: Represent power, wisdom, strength, and good fortune. Dragons are mythical creatures with a long history in various cultures.
Religious and Spiritual Tattoos
For many men, tattoos serve as a form of religious or spiritual expression. These designs can represent faith, devotion, and a connection to something larger than oneself. Exploring tattoo designs and meanings for men within this category offers a profound way to showcase personal beliefs.
- Cross Tattoos: Symbolize faith, sacrifice, and redemption in Christianity. Different styles of crosses can hold varying meanings.
- Om Tattoos: Represent the sacred sound and spiritual symbol in Hinduism, signifying the essence of the universe.
- Buddha Tattoos: Symbolize enlightenment, peace, and compassion in Buddhism.
- Angel Tattoos: Represent protection, guidance, and spirituality. They can also symbolize remembrance of a loved one.
Nautical Tattoos
Nautical tattoos have a rich history rooted in seafaring traditions. These designs often represent adventure, exploration, and a connection to the sea. Among the classic tattoo designs and meanings for men, nautical themes hold a timeless appeal.
- Anchor Tattoos: Symbolize stability, hope, and grounding. They are often chosen by those who have weathered storms and found their footing.
- Compass Tattoos: Represent guidance, direction, and the journey of life. They can symbolize finding one’s way and staying true to one’s path.
- Ship Tattoos: Symbolize adventure, exploration, and the challenges of life’s journey. They can also represent a longing for home.
- Sailor Jerry Tattoos: A classic style featuring bold lines and vibrant colors, often depicting nautical themes like anchors, ships, and swallows.
Geometric and Abstract Tattoos
Geometric and abstract tattoos offer a modern and minimalist approach to body art. These designs often focus on shapes, patterns, and symmetry, creating visually striking and thought-provoking pieces. The tattoo designs and meanings for men in this category are often open to interpretation.
- Sacred Geometry Tattoos: Feature geometric patterns believed to hold spiritual significance, such as the Flower of Life and Metatron’s Cube.
- Mandala Tattoos: Represent the universe, wholeness, and spiritual harmony. They are often used as a tool for meditation and self-reflection.
- Minimalist Tattoos: Feature simple lines and shapes, conveying meaning through subtlety and understatement.
Choosing the Right Tattoo Design
Selecting the right tattoo design is a personal and important decision. Consider the following factors when making your choice:
- Meaning: Choose a design that resonates with your values, beliefs, and experiences. The tattoo designs and meanings for men should reflect something significant in your life.
- Placement: Consider where you want the tattoo to be placed on your body. Different placements can affect the visibility and impact of the design.
- Style: Choose a style that appeals to your aesthetic preferences, whether it’s traditional, modern, minimalist, or something else entirely.
- Artist: Research and select a tattoo artist who specializes in the style you’re looking for. Look at their portfolio and read reviews to ensure they are skilled and reputable.
- Size: Think about the size of the tattoo and how it will fit on your chosen body part. Larger designs can be more impactful, while smaller designs can be more subtle.
